Between April 2025 and April 2026, the Lagos State Special Offences (Mobile) Court said adjudicated and prosecuted a total of 58,342 cases across various offences including traffic violations such as obstruction of highways, reckless driving and resisting arrest.





The highest number of cases recorded during the period under review involved :

• Conduct likely to cause breach of peace – 22,238 cases

• Failure to patronize approved PSP operators – 11,690 cases

• Driving on BRT corridors/wilful obstruction – 5,181 cases

• Unlawful conversion of government/private property – 4,926 cases

• Wilful obstruction on highways – 3,630 cases

• Street trading – 2,896 cases





• Sanitation Offences – 11,790 cases

This data was shared on the official social media platforms of the Lagos State Government, including its Facebook page, as part of activities to mark the third anniversary of Governor Babajide Sanwo-Olu’s second term.

During this period, the Lagos Mobile Court also intensified public sensitization and enlightenment campaigns through radio and television platforms to promote compliance with traffic and environmental laws.

In addition, annual management retreats were organized during the review period to enhance institutional effectiveness and service delivery.

The Lagos State Special Offences (Mobile) Court is a decentralized, on-the-spot judicial mechanism designed to summarily try and penalize minor infractions such as traffic violations, environmental abuses, and public nuisance offenses across the state.

It works with agencies like Lagos State Taskforce, Lagos State Traffic Management Authority ( LASTMA), Federal Road Safety Corps (FRSC), Lagos State Waste Management Agency (LAWMA), Lagos Metropolitan Area Transport Authority (LAMATA), Vehicle Inspection Service (VIS) and Kick Against Indiscipline (KAI).
